WE NEED MACHINISTS – Good pay, great place to work! CNC Machinist Mastercam November 19, 2019 by mbwpadmin Employer: FM PRODUCTS INC Location : Boise ID US A job for which military experienced candidates are encouraged to apply. This position would be a great fit for people with Military experience! More >>